Why Is bournemouth vs liverpool Trending Today?

The topic “Bournemouth vs Liverpool” is currently trending with over 100K searches primarily due to a recent match where Bournemouth achieved a surprising victory over Liverpool at the Vitality Stadium. This unexpected outcome has captured significant attention from football fans and analysts alike, leading to increased search interest.

Furthermore, major sports news outlets such as NBC Sports and BBC have provided live updates, score analysis, and highlights related to the match. These platforms routinely generate high traffic during prominent fixtures, contributing to the surge in search volume as fans seek real-time information and insights about the game.

Additionally, the match’s implications within the Premier League and the competitive nature of the teams involved have drawn heightened interest. As both teams are prominent fixtures in English football, any noteworthy results tend to provoke significant public curiosity, which is reflected in the search data.
